Could Alex have talented duo back for derby clash?


Crewe Alexandra is hoping to be handed a boost ahead of this weekend’s local derby against Port Vale. The club’s injured duo of Matt Tootle and Ryan Colclough are expected to resume training later this week after making progress in relation to their injuries.



Tootle had a scan last week after complaining of pain in his foot and was given the all clear, while winger Colclough had to pull out of training as a precaution after suffering some tightness in his hamstring.


If neither suffers any reaction this week they could be considered for the visit of the Valiants. They both remain doubts at the moment though.



Steve told the club’s official web-site: “Both Toots and Ryan are hoping to train this week. They are keen to give it a go possibly Wednesday, Thursday.


“Toots’ foot is getting better and he has a chance of making the weekend. We’ll have to see how he goes this week.



“Ryan felt his hamstring tighten when he came back into training. He tweaked it a bit and we took him out.


“It would be a risk, a gamble to include him because we don’t know what the muscle is like until he steps up his rehab. Hopefully, it will be fine and he trains well but we don’t want to risk losing him for longer by taking a risk.”
